Leading Threat Intelligence Tools for Early Cybersecurity
Staying ahead of sophisticated cyber risks requires robust than reactive responses. Utilizing threat intelligence is critical , and several impressive tools now exist to assist security professionals in obtaining a preventative stance. Popular options include CrowdStrike Falcon, Recorded Future, Anomali ThreatStream, and MISP, each delivering unique capabilities for collecting indicators of compromise and predicting potential incidents . Selecting the right tool depends on your company's specific needs and financial resources .

Leveraging Cyber Threat Intelligence: Platforms & Practical Applications
Effectively utilizing cyber threat data requires more than just collecting raw feeds. Organizations are increasingly adopting dedicated threat intelligence platforms to analyze and implement this vital knowledge. These modern platforms, like Recorded Future, Anomali, and ThreatConnect, centralize intelligence from diverse sources, including dark web forums , vulnerability lists, and industry publications . Practical deployments range from proactive risk hunting and network response to enhancing existing protections and customizing security rules . Furthermore, threat intelligence can be embedded into SIEMs (Security Management and Event Management) and SOAR (Security Orchestration, Automation and Response) platforms to automate processes and decrease remediation efforts .
